Definition

Punon, a settlement or encampment east of the Arabah, identified as a station of the Israelites during their wilderness journey. The word functions as a toponym rather than a common noun, denoting a specific location encountered by the Israelites after leaving Mount Hor. Its precise etymological meaning is uncertain, but it may reflect a local place name preserved in tradition or derived from a geographic feature.

Root / Etymology

Root uncertain. Possibly related to the root פּון (pûn), which is itself rare and of uncertain meaning; the best-attested derivative occurs only in toponyms. There is no securely established root meaning attested elsewhere in Hebrew.

Historical & Contextual Notes

Punon appears only in Numbers 33:42–43 as an Israelite encampment during the wilderness wanderings. Its exact geographic identification remains debated, though some scholars propose a site among the copper-mining regions east of the central Arabah. The term has no broader semantic range and is not reused elsewhere in the Hebrew Bible. Later sources and translations simply transliterate the name. The Hebrew form preserves a non-Israelite or regional designation rather than a uniquely Israelite place-name. English translations (e.g., KJV, NRSV) consistently render it as 'Punon' with no added interpretive gloss, reflecting its status as a proper noun.
